ok bro the traction control buttons are right above the unlock mechanism for the hood. If you dont have anything there you have a base model.

The only models with cloth seats are the enthusiast and the base models, every model after that has leather.

if you have regular brakes, you have a base

if you dont have any steering wheel controls you have a base model.
